IMPORTANT NOTICE


Starting in June 17th, 2006, 10-digit local dialing will be standard practice across most of Ontario and Quebec.

Please make sure that your dialup connection settings include the area code before June 17, 2006
.

Affected regions:

418 Eastern Quebec
450 Montreal's surrounding regions
514 Island of Montreal
519 South-Western Ontario
613 Eastern Ontario
705 North-Eastern Ontario
819 Northern, Central and Western Quebec
